GUERRA, Dominican Republic – After four strong games in the Dominican Republic, the Junior National Team ran into some adversity today against the Houston Astros Dominican prospects and came out on the wrong end of a 13-6 decision. The juniors committed five errors, walked six and allowed thirteen hits including a pair of home runs. The loss puts the Junior National Team’s record at 3-2 with nine games remaining on the tour.
LA GINA, Dominican Republic – Wesley Moore (Surrey, BC) and Carson Perkins (Bienfait, SK) limited the Chicago Cubs Dominican squad to just one run and six hits, while Andrew Yerzy (Toronto, ON) drove in three runs as the Junior National Team handed the Cubs a 5-1 loss. The win improves the Junior National Team’s record to 3-1 with ten games remaining in the Dominican Summer League tour.
SAN PEDRO DE MACORIS/BOCA CHICA, DR – Four Junior National Team pitchers toed the rubber today to combine for 18 innings of work and just one earned run was charged. Unfortunately it game on a walk off single as the Toronto Blue Jays beat the juniors 2-1 in the second game, but prior to that, the juniors earned a 10-2 win over the Milwaukee Brewers Dominican club. The Junior National Team’s record through three games now sits at 2-1.
BOCA CHICA, DR – The Junior National Team held their traditional Dominican Summer League opener against the Minnesota Twins this afternoon and came away with a 3-2 win on the strength of a pair of solid pitching performances from veterans Josh Burgmann (Nanaimo, BC) and Mathieu Deneault-Gauthier (Candiac, QC).

OTTAWA – The Caraquet Minor Baseball Association has joined Baseball Canada’s growing list of associations that meet the Reaching Baseball Ideals Program’s national standards. Caraquet Minor Baseball is now the fifth association in New Brunswick and the 42nd in the country to receive RBI approved status.

OTTAWA – The 2014 edition of the Junior National Team will be best remembered for winning a bronze medal at the COPABE 18U Pan American “AA” Championships in La Paz, Mexico that earned Canada a spot in the 2015 WBSC U-18 Baseball World Cup and also surviving Hurricane Odile that delayed the teams’ departure from the country.
